The “Imp. Peach Mint IPA” (8.8% ABV, 72 IBU) was brewed with Azacca Hops and real peach puree to provide a wonderful bouquet tropical fruit and peach flavors. Fresh mint was used in the dry-hops to give a more effervescent character, but mostly to complete the allegory.

16oz can poured into 12oz tulip. Poured a cloudy dark yellow color with 1/4 inch of white head that had low retention and lacing.
The aroma had low malt/grain, light peach, undetectable mint, and some bright hops.
Similar taste profile, with some bitterness on the finish.
The body was on the light side of medium, and had a dry finish.
drinkability was good,m although I'm not sure I'd want two in a row.
Overall, a solid brew, worth a shot if you see it.
